from __future__ import print_function
import numpy as np
import matplotlib.pyplot as plt
import pyspike as spk
spike_trains = spk.load_spike_trains_from_txt("PySpike_testdata.txt",
time_interval=(0, 4000))
print(spike_trains[0])
print(spike_trains[1])
# plt.plot(spike_trains[0], np.ones_like(spike_trains[0]), 'o')
# plt.plot(spike_trains[1], np.zeros_like(spike_trains[1]), 'o')
plt.figure()
f = spk.spike_sync_profile(spike_trains[0], spike_trains[1])
x, y = f.get_plottable_data()
plt.plot(x, y, '--k', label="SPIKE-SYNC profile")
print(x)
print(y)
f = spk.spike_profile(spike_trains[0], spike_trains[1])
x, y = f.get_plottable_data()
plt.plot(x, y, '-b', label="SPIKE-profile")
plt.legend(loc="upper left")
plt.show()
